Home
last modified time | relevance | path

Searched refs:GPIOIE (Results 1 – 2 of 2) sorted by relevance

/Linux-v6.1/drivers/gpio/
Dgpio-pl061.c32 #define GPIOIE 0x410 macro
240 gpioie = readb(pl061->base + GPIOIE) & ~mask; in pl061_irq_mask()
241 writeb(gpioie, pl061->base + GPIOIE); in pl061_irq_mask()
257 gpioie = readb(pl061->base + GPIOIE) | mask; in pl061_irq_unmask()
258 writeb(gpioie, pl061->base + GPIOIE); in pl061_irq_unmask()
339 writeb(0, pl061->base + GPIOIE); /* disable irqs */ in pl061_probe()
378 pl061->csave_regs.gpio_ie = readb(pl061->base + GPIOIE); in pl061_suspend()
406 writeb(pl061->csave_regs.gpio_ie, pl061->base + GPIOIE); in pl061_resume()
/Linux-v6.1/drivers/pinctrl/starfive/
Dpinctrl-starfive-jh7100.c76 #define GPIOIE 0x028 macro
1072 void __iomem *ie = sfp->base + GPIOIE + 4 * (gpio / 32); in starfive_irq_mask()
1089 void __iomem *ie = sfp->base + GPIOIE + 4 * (gpio / 32); in starfive_irq_mask_ack()
1106 void __iomem *ie = sfp->base + GPIOIE + 4 * (gpio / 32); in starfive_irq_unmask()
1210 writel(0, sfp->base + GPIOIE + 0); in starfive_gpio_init_hw()
1211 writel(0, sfp->base + GPIOIE + 4); in starfive_gpio_init_hw()